This wasn’t their silver medal winning performance. Actual competitive programs are much harder than that. The team that won did a routine to Pink Panther with the female in a pink catsuit…
They are thrilled with silver though. Tatiana and Maxim just started skating together this season. They both skated with other people/other countries until recently. Maxim always skated for Russia, but Tatiana for the Ukranians.
The Ukranians are currently cursed with the best female pairs skaters in the World. Two girls originally from the Ukranian (Aliona now skating for Germany) and Tatiana were 1-2 at this years worlds. The joke is Aliona was cloned and then came Tatiana. :Lol: The story is though that the Ukranians had no decent male partners for them, that could win World titles/didn’t make the effort. So Aliona went to Germany and is now a 3 time world champ, Olympic medalist. And last year there began talk that Tatiana would be looking for a new partner. With about ever male pairs skater/skating country hoping Tatiana would pick THEM. The Russians won that sweepstakes because Trankov is probably the best males skater in the world. And we had a new dream team. They are already amazing (this exhibition doesn’t really show their stuff) but will be even better in time. A lot of people think this team will win Gold in Sochi.
